May 9, 2001 INDIANAPOLIS - Veteran Indy Racing driver Dr. Jack Miller announced May 8 that he will not participate in the 85th Indianapolis 500, instead concentrating on his recovery from a concussion suffered in a racing crash last month. May 8, 2001 SPEEDWAY, Ind. - He did it in 1999, and despite saying, "I'll never do that again," Stewart will indeed be pulling double duty for the second time in three years by competing in the Indianapolis 500 and the Coca-Cola 600 on the same day - May 27.
